Now that you know what to expect, let’s focus on the positive aspects of 98402 zip code map. One of the most popular tourist attractions in this area is the Museum of Glass. Here, you can admire stunning works of art and learn about the history of glassmaking. Another must-see destination is the Tacoma Art Museum, which features a wide range of exhibits and events. If you’re interested in history, you might also want to check out the Washington State History Museum. And of course, no trip to Tacoma would be complete without a visit to the iconic Tacoma Dome, a massive indoor arena that hosts concerts, sports events, and more.

What Are Some of the Best Events to Attend in 98402 Zip Code Map?
If you’re interested in experiencing the local culture of 98402 zip code map firsthand, there are plenty of events and activities to choose from. Some popular options include the Tacoma Art Walk, which takes place on the third Thursday of each month and features art exhibits, live music, and food vendors. Another highlight is the Tacoma Farmers Market, which is open on Saturdays and offers a wide range of fresh produce, artisanal goods, and prepared foods. Finally, the Tacoma Film Festival is a can’t-miss event for movie buffs, with screenings of independent films from around the world.
Answering FAQs About 98402 Zip Code Map
Q: What is the best way to get around 98402 zip code map?
A: The 98402 zip code map is relatively compact, so it’s easy to explore on foot. However, if you prefer to use public transportation, there are several options available, including buses and light rail.
Q: Are there any free activities to do in 98402 zip code map?
A: Yes, there are several free attractions in this area, such as the Dale Chihuly Bridge of Glass, which is a stunning outdoor installation that spans a highway. You can also visit the Tacoma Art Museum for free on the third Thursday of each month.
Q: What are some good places to eat in 98402 zip code map?
A: There are numerous restaurants and cafes in this area, ranging from casual to upscale. Some popular options include Pacific Grill, The Social Bar and Grill, and Anthem Coffee and Tea.
